do-release-upgrade жалуется, что система устарела

do-release-upgrade жалуется, что система устарела

Вот именно, do-release-upgradeжалуется, что система не обновлена, хотя apt upgradeи apt dist-upgradeпоказывает, что все обновлено. А ты выдергиваешь клочья волос. Что происходит?

решение1

Я уже писал о некоторых проблемах, вызванных трижды проклятой сборкой Libreoffice 5.3. Что ж, прошли годы, но эта проклятая штука вернулась, чтобы укусить! Я уверен, что репозитории для нее давно мертвы, и, конечно, ничего нельзя обновить, особенно учитывая, что у меня даже эта версия больше не установлена. Но, конечно, мой монстр-компьютер все еще жив и очень здоров. Успешно обновился до 18.04LTS сегодня.

Итак, чтобы иметь возможность выполнить обновление, оказалось, что нужно было очистить список репозиториев. Запустите software-properties-gtkи снимите отметки со всех репозиториев, кроме основных Ubuntu. Libreoffice 5.3 в частности все еще был там и все еще выбран. Может быть, потому что я наивно установил его с Ubuntu Software давным-давно.

В любом случае, после того, как этот список был очищен, do-release-upgradeон запустился без каких-либо проблем. Но давайте поговорим о вредителе пакета!

Так что если у кого-то обновление зависнет, заявив, что что-то устарело, очистите список репозитория, и все должно пройти без сучка и задоринки.

Связанный контент